Principals want overhaul of initial teacher education John Gerritsen © RNZ/ Dan Cook Principals are calling for an overhaul of initial teacher education, because some newly qualified primary teachers are ill-prepared to teach basic subjects like reading and maths. The Principals Federation, the Educational Institute, and the Normal and Model School Association told RNZ many new graduates had studied how to be a teacher for just one year and that was not enough. They said recent Teaching Council changes to the requirements that teacher education courses must meet would help, ...
